The Makings of an Artist

Marko Stout’s early exposure to art and painting came from his neighbor in San Francisco Bay. Marko gained interest in art and films and embarked on his unconventional foray in contemporary art and multimedia. Marko’s neighbor presented his early compositions in his private galleries. The early success in these exhibitions laid the path for Marco’s creative career. When Marko moved to New York City, his art and personality merged well in the city’s art culture and finally emerged as an enrapturing narrative.
